A Software Engineering Leader is responsible for driving team performance and ensuring the delivery of highquality software aligned with IFSs R&D Product Strategy. They play a pivotal role in establishing and refining processes that support efficient secure and reliable software development following the 7-Stages Development Process. By closely collaborating with Product and Program Management they articulate the What and Why to their teams creating a clear and purpose-driven plan for development efforts.
Maintaining smooth consistent development processes is a key responsibility with a focus on timely delivery quality and performance. These processes include but are not limited to automated testing at multiple levels code reviews security reviews and the evolution of the architecture. To ensure overall development efficiency a Software Engineering Leader prioritizes smooth workflows and collaboration across teams proactively identifying and resolving bottlenecks. They partner with Quality Assurance Leader to embed quality into the planning and execution stages and maintain a right first time approach to software development. They also ensure close collaboration with the other R&D teams to deliver software that meets user expectations.
A Software Engineering Leader is accountable for fostering a high-performing team culture and is responsible for appraising their direct reports. They coach and develop team members providing them with challenging yet achievable goals to promote personal growth and career progression. They are proactive in addressing poor performance ensuring the well-being of both the individual and the team. Recruitment onboarding and continuous upskilling of team members are integral to their role as is building a resilient and adaptable team.
Building strong stakeholder relationships across IFS including with support teams is vital to this role. They aim to minimize R&D effort spent on support by delivering well-documented high-quality software and addressing escalations efficiently. Prompt engagement with Support Leaders allows them to identify concerns and take timely affirmative action to resolve issues.
By focusing on performance accountability and process excellence Software Engineering Leaders ensure their teams consistently deliver secure performant and innovative solutions that meet organizational and customer needs
